Early Origins of the Grobe family

The surname Grobe was first found in Mecklenburg, where the name Gruben contributed greatly to the development of an emerging nation, and would later play a large role in the tribal and national conflicts of the area. Over time, the Gruben family name branched into other houses, where their influence continued to be felt because of the important role they played in the local social and political affairs.

Grobe Spelling Variations

Spelling variations of this family name include: Gruben, Grubbe, Grubben, Grüben, Grubel, Grubendal, Gruber, Grüber, Grubenhaus and many more.

United States Grobe migration to the United States +

Some of the first settlers of this family name were:

Grobe Settlers in United States in the 19th Century
  • Henry Grobe, who arrived in Pennsylvania in 1804 [1]
  • J Anthony Grobe, who landed in Pennsylvania in 1804 [1]
  • Peter Grobe, aged 28, who landed in Missouri in 1840 [1]
  • Heinrich Grobe, who landed in Galveston, Tex in 1845 aboard the ship "Hercules" [1]
  • Mrs. Marie Cath. Grobe, (nee Wolbers), German who arrived in Galveston, Texas in 1845 aboard the ship "Hercules"
